Obsah:

Rotující ventilátor pomocí servomotoru a ovládání rychlosti: 6 kroků
Rotující ventilátor pomocí servomotoru a ovládání rychlosti: 6 kroků

Video: Rotující ventilátor pomocí servomotoru a ovládání rychlosti: 6 kroků

Video: Rotující ventilátor pomocí servomotoru a ovládání rychlosti: 6 kroků
Video: Control Position and Speed of Stepper motor with L298N module using Arduino 2024, Listopad
Anonim
Image
Image

V tomto tutoriálu se naučíme otáčet ventilátor s nastavitelnou rychlostí pomocí servomotoru, potenciometru, arduina a Visuina.

Podívejte se na video!

Krok 1: Co budete potřebovat

Co budete potřebovat
Co budete potřebovat
Co budete potřebovat
Co budete potřebovat
  • Arduino UNO (nebo jakákoli jiná deska)
  • Modul ventilátoru
  • Potenciometr
  • Servomotor
  • Propojovací vodiče
  • Program Visuino: Stáhněte si Visuino

Krok 2: Okruh

Okruh
Okruh
Okruh
Okruh
  • Připojte pin „oranžového“(signálního) servomotoru k digitálnímu pinu Arduino [2]
  • Připojte „červený“pin servomotoru k kladnému pinu Arduino [5V]
  • Připojte „hnědý“pin servomotoru k zápornému pinu Arduino [GND]
  • Připojte pin potenciometru [DTB] k analogovému pinu arduino [A0]
  • Připojte pin potenciometru [VCC] k pinu arduino [5V]
  • Připojte pin potenciometru [GND] k arduino pinu [GND]
  • Připojte pin modulu ventilátoru [VCC] k pinu Arduino [5V]
  • Připojte pin modulu ventilátoru [GND] ke kolíku Arduino [GND]
  • Připojte pin modulu ventilátoru [INA] k digitálnímu kolíku arduino [5]

Krok 3: Spusťte Visuino a vyberte typ desky Arduino UNO

Spusťte Visuino a vyberte typ desky Arduino UNO
Spusťte Visuino a vyberte typ desky Arduino UNO
Spusťte Visuino a vyberte typ desky Arduino UNO
Spusťte Visuino a vyberte typ desky Arduino UNO

Je třeba nainstalovat Visuino: https://www.visuino.eu. Spusťte Visuino, jak je znázorněno na prvním obrázku Klikněte na tlačítko „Nástroje“na komponentě Arduino (obrázek 1) ve Visuinu Když se zobrazí dialogové okno, vyberte „Arduino UNO“, jak je znázorněno na obrázku 2

Krok 4: V aplikaci Visuino přidejte, nastavte a připojte součásti

V aplikaci Visuino přidávejte, nastavujte a připojujte komponenty
V aplikaci Visuino přidávejte, nastavujte a připojujte komponenty
V aplikaci Visuino přidávejte, nastavujte a připojujte komponenty
V aplikaci Visuino přidávejte, nastavujte a připojujte komponenty
V aplikaci Visuino přidávejte, nastavujte a připojujte komponenty
V aplikaci Visuino přidávejte, nastavujte a připojujte komponenty
V aplikaci Visuino přidávejte, nastavujte a připojujte komponenty
V aplikaci Visuino přidávejte, nastavujte a připojujte komponenty
  • Přidat „Sine Analog Generator“
  • Přidat „servo“
  • Vyberte „SineAnalogGenerator1“a v okně vlastností nastavte Amplitudu na 0,30 a Frekvenci na 0,1
  • Připojte analogový pinový výstup desky Arduino (0) k digitálnímu pinovému vstupu desky Arduino (5)
  • Připojte SineAnalogGenerator 1 pin (Out) k Servo1 pin (In)
  • Připojte pin Servo1 (výstup) k digitálnímu vstupu Pin na desce Arduino (2)

Krok 5: Generujte, kompilujte a nahrajte kód Arduino

Generujte, kompilujte a nahrajte kód Arduino
Generujte, kompilujte a nahrajte kód Arduino

Ve Visuinu ve spodní části klikněte na kartu „Build“, ujistěte se, že je vybrán správný port, poté klikněte na tlačítko „Compile/Build and Upload“.

Krok 6: Hrajte

Pokud napájíte modul Arduino UNO, servomotor se začne sčítat a modul ventilátoru se začne točit, rychlost ventilátoru můžete upravit potenciometrem. Podívejte se na video s ukázkou detailů.

Gratulujeme! Dokončili jste svůj projekt s Visuino. Také je připojen projekt Visuino, který jsem vytvořil pro tento Instructable, můžete si jej stáhnout a otevřít ve Visuinu:

Doporučuje: